(1) No child(ren) shall be left without the supervision of a teacher at any time, except as specified in Sections 101216.2(e)(1) and 101230(c)(1). Supervision shall include visual observation. This requirement was not met as evidenced by: Based on record review and interview, the Licensee did not comply with the above by leaving a child without supervision in a classroom. This posed an immediate risk to the health or safety of children in care.
Administration of Child Day Care Licensing Subsequent to initial licensure, a person specified in subdivision (b) who is not exempt from fingerprinting shall obtain either a criminal record clearance or an exemption from disqualification, pursuant to subdivision(f) of this section or Section 1522.7, from the State Department of Social Services prior to employment, residence, or initial presence in the facility.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Based on record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above by not associating S1 to the facility prior to the initial annual visit on 7/9/2025 which posed a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.

Teacher-Child Ratio (a) There shall be a ratio of one teacher visually observing and supervising no more than 12 children in attendance, except as specified in (b) and (c) below.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Based on observation,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above by having one teacher supervising 12 napping children and 4 awake children, which posed a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.
(d) Upon the occurrence... a report shall be made to the Department by telephone or fax within the Department's next working day and during its normal business hours. In addition, a written report containing the information specified in (d)(2) below shall be submitted to the Department within seven days following the occurrence of such event. This requirement was not met as evidenced by: Based on record review, the Licensee did not comply with the above by not submitting a written report within seven days of an unusual incident occurring. This posed a potential risk to the health and safety of children in care.

Personnel Requirements (f) At least one staff member who is trained in pediatric cardiopulmonary resuscitation and pediatric first aid pursuant to Health and Safety Code Section 1596.866 shall be present when children are at the child care center or offsite for center activities.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Based on interview and record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above by not enrolling staff for an EMSA certified training course which poses a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.
